In most cases, professional organizers are well worth the investment. They often handle decluttering, which can take hours of work, and professional home and garage organization solutions that homeowners wouldn’t often think about. In many cases, homeowners will recognize the true value of a professional organizer during the weeks following the project’s finish when they use their new space and realize the improved quality of life that comes with convenient and thoughtful storage and organization.
The average cost to hire a handyman ranges from about $40 to $140 per hour. Average project cost ranges between $180 and $700, but the cost per hour and per project depends heavily on the type, size, and complexity of the project. The pro’s experience level and your location also factor into how much a handyman charges per hour or per project. You can also expect to pay higher rates or additional fees for emergency services, or around periods of high customer demand, like holidays.
Landscapers typically charge $25 to $50 per person per hour, which equals around $50 to $100 per hour for a two-person crew. These rates can vary depending on your location, the size of staff needed for the job, and overall job type. For example, a larger crew will be needed for structural additions and hardscaping versus planting flowers.
When it comes to landscapers, licensing laws vary. Landscaping architects are required to be licensed in all 50 states, whereas traditional landscaping contractors are not typically required to hold a certification. You’ll likely be working with a landscaping contractor for most residential projects. If you are redesigning your whole yard or adding in hardscape features, you will work with a landscaping architect at some point during the project. Professional organizers charge $55 to $100 per hour, with average per-project rates costing $510. If you need help with basic decluttering and organizing of your garage, expect to pay $200 to $700. On the other hand, major reorganization projects can cost $1,500 to $5,000, including installing shelves and storage solutions. Expect to pay more for professional organization help if you need specialty storage solutions, like cabinets and toolboxes for a workshop or a ceiling-mounted kayak or bike storage option.
